Primavera udesigner Overview Primavera udesigner is a functional module of Primavera Unifier and is enabled automatically when a "product/application" is installed. Primavera udesigner provides a flexible and sophisticated design tool for those customers who want to create and publish their own customized business processes (BPs). Once a business process has been created and completed in Primavera udesigner, it can be tested on a Primavera Unifier staging environment. A Primavera Unifier staging environment is a Primavera Unifier server deployed without checking the "Production" configuration checkbox in the Configurator. (You select this staging and production environments in the Unifier Configurator.) The staging environment allows each business process to be tested for completeness and functionality. After the business process has been tested and meets your requirements, it can then be imported into the Primavera Unifier production environment and used by active Primavera Unifier users. Note: Primavera ustage is a testing Environment that replicates the Primavera Unifier production environment. It must be set up just like production. Business processes can be deployed multiple times on Primavera ustage. The Company Administrator has the access to udesigner only when the Unifier Server Type is set to Staging mode. If the Server Type is set to Production mode, the administrator will be able to import the business processes and designs but will not be able access the udesigner tool. Cluster Support Primavera Unifier includes support for setting up multiple Unifier Application servers within a cluster environment. For cluster configuration, you can add another Unifier Application server in a cluster by repeating the steps to install and configure Unifier, and configure the web server on a new server machine. If you are using Microsoft Application Center for clustering, you must set the NLB client affinity to Internet (Single) in order to maintain connection consistency. Clustering is achieved using hardware such as Cisco Load Balancing Switch. When hardware clustering is used, the configuration of session stickiness should be used. 8 Chapter 1 Installing Primavera Unifier This chapter describes how to: Install Primavera Unifier Prerequisites Create an installation account on the server that has full administration privileges. You will need to use this account for maintenance and upgrades. Installing Primavera Unifier To install Unifier 1. Unzip the media pack for release Use the Unifier_sh_ exe file. 2. Double-click on Unifier_sh_ exe to begin installation. The Unifier Setup Wizard opens. 3. Click Next. The Server Installation Options window opens. 4. From the Type of Install dropdown menu, select Application Server and click Next. The Specify Installation Location window opens. 5. In the Destination Folder field, enter (or Browse to) the folder in which you want to install the Unifier software (for example, C:\Unifier). Do not install to a folder within Program Files or to any folder with a space in the folder name. Long path names and names with spaces may cause problems. It is highly recommended that you install Unifier at the root of the specified drive. 6. Click Install. The installation begins. This may take several minutes. The installation is complete when the Installation Summary window opens. If there were problems with the installation process, the Summary window will display error messages. You may need to re-start the installation/configuration process. 7. Click Next. The Completing the Unifier Setup Wizard window opens Do NOT select the Run Unifier Server Configurator checkbox in the Installation 8. Click Finish. Once the Unifier files have been successfully installed, proceed to configuring Unifier. See Chapter 2 Configuring the Database Server for more information. 9 Chapter 2 Configuring the Database Server This chapter describes how to configure the database server. Configuring the Oracle Database Server The following is an overview of the steps required to configure the Oracle database for use with Unifier. Refer to your Oracle documentation for more information and specific instructions. To configure the Oracle database for use with Primavera Unifier 1. Create an instance for the database. 2. Create a user account on the newly created database. For successful Primavera Unifier/uDesigner installation, make sure ample free space (~100GB) is available for the default tablespace where the new user will be located. 3. Grant the new user with connect, resource, create view privileges. Note: This information will be needed later for setting database information within the Unifier Configurator (under the Database tab). Configuring the SQL Database Server The following is an overview of the steps required to configure the Microsoft SQL database for use with Unifier. Refer to your SQL documentation for more information and specific instructions. To configure the Microsoft SQL database for use with Unifier 1. Create a new database to be used with Unifier. 2. Create a user account for the newly created database. 3. Use the default SQL configuration. You need to assign the user as db_owner or Unifier will not work. Note: This information will be needed later for setting database information within the Unifier Configurator (under the Database tab). Copyright 1998, 2012 Oracle and/or its affiliates. 11 Chapter 4 Installing AutoVue Server (Optional) AutoVue installation is mandatory if you plan to use Unifier s Markup feature, also referred to as redlining. When attaching documents to a Business Process form, you can add markups, such as text notes or graphical elements, to the document, which display directly on the document but do not alter it. Note: You must have a license to install AutoVue. This chapter includes: Install steps for AutoVue Steps for AutoVue that need to be completed in the Unifier Configurator Install steps for latest Service Pack Steps to copy/paste GUI configuration files Required Components AutoVue Web AutoVue Install AutoVue Web 1. Choose the desired server and run the installation by selecting the AutoVue installation file and click Next. 2. Click Yes. 3. Enter your user name in the User Name field. 4. Enter your company name in the Company field. 5. Click Next and follow the installation. The installation automatically enters the server name (host name) where the installation is being performed on. 6. Click Next. 7. Accept the host name and click Next. 8. Click Yes. 9. Change the port number from 80 to 5099 (or whatever port number you decide to use). 10. Click Next and follow the installation wizard. To function properly, you need Microsoft Visual C ++ and it will be automatically installed on your system, if it is not already installed. 11. Click Finish. 13 Chapter 5 Configuring Primavera Unifier This chapter describes how to: Change Unifier Service and Xref Service login accounts Configure Unifier using Unifier Configurator Changing Service Login Accounts Note: Two roles participate in getting Primavera Unifier up and running: The network administrator and the site administrator. The network administrator downloads and installs Primavera Unifier and all related services. The site administrator creates the Primavera Unifier company, which includes completing company properties, and loading modules. During installation the network administrator installs Unifier, the Unifier Service, Xref Service, and the udesigner Service. The site administrator then logs into Primavera Unifier to create the company entity, complete company properties, and load modules for both Unifier and udesigner. To change the Login Accounts 1. From the Windows Start menu, click Programs > Administrative Tools > Services. The Services window opens. 2. Right-click on Unifier Service and select Properties. The Properties window opens. 3. Click the Log On tab. 4. Click the Browse button and choose the user who will administer the Primavera Unifier account. 5. Click OK and close the Services window. 6. Repeat the above steps for the Xref service. Configuring Primavera Unifier The Primavera Unifier environment is configured through the Unifier Configurator window. To change settings within Unifier Configurator 1. From the Windows Start menu, click Programs > Unifier > Unifier Configurator. 2. Right-click and select Run as administrator. The Unifier Configurator window opens. 3. Configure the settings for each of the tabs as described in the following sections. Server Port Tab Server Local Port: Port used by Unifier to handle http requests. Note: If IIS is running on your environment, enter a different port from the default, such as Local Worker Port: Port used by Unifier to communicate with the Microsoft IIS Web server. If you change the value of the Local Worker Port, then during configuration of the Web Server Filter you will need to change the parameter for isapifilter\conf\worker.properties to the value you chose: Worker.ajp13.port <value> Copyright 1998, 2012 Oracle and/or its affiliates. 14 Repository Tab There are two data repositories (folders in which Unifier data is stored), which Unifier requires you to configure. There are additional repositories, such as the archive directory for project archiving, that are used with specific features, as described below. These can be located on a local but separate hard drive, or on a mapped drive on your network. It is important to plan where these directories are located because they are where Unifier data is stored. Any subsequent upgrade installations need to point to these same two directories in order for Unifier to see data previously entered. These repositories, in addition to your database, should be backed up regularly. When naming the folders, be sure there are no spaces in the folder names. File Directory: Enter (or Browse to) the path where uploaded or attached files are stored. This repository is for storing documents within the Document Manager, such as drawings, plans, Word documents, etc. These files will be available for viewing or attaching to business process forms within Unifier. It also stores imported schedule files. These files must be on a shared drive that is accessible by other server machines that are operating in a clustering environment. Index Directory: This folder is for index files used in Document Manager search function. Archive Directory: For project archiving capability. Default value is d:\projectarchive. (See Appendix B: Archiving for more information about archiving.) Archive Temp Directory: For temporary archived files. Default value is d:\temp. Web Service Audit Directory: This folder stores files for Web Services calls. Dashboard Data Directory: This folder stores the.swf and XML files used with custom dashboards. Database Tab (Oracle) The information entered in this tab is based on your earlier database and user account creation. Database Type: Select Oracle. Host Name: Enter the host name of the computer where you installed the database. Instance ID: Enter the Instance ID for the database. Port: Enter the Port number to be used by Unifier to communicate with the database (for example, 1522). User Name: Enter the database login user account name (created in Oracle) to be used by Unifier. The database login user account needs to have sufficient permissions to create tables in order for Unifier to work correctly. User Password: Enter the database login user account password to be used by Unifier. Database Name: This field is not applicable for Oracle. Max. Connections: The setting that defines the maximum connections to the database. The maximum is 400; the recommended maximum is 80 to 100. Min. Connections: The setting that defines the minimum connections that must be connected to the database. Copyright 1998, 2012 Oracle and/or its affiliates. All Rights Reserved. 10

15 Click Test Connection to verify that the Application server and the database are connected and communicating. A Test is successful message will popup if test is successful. Two conditions are tested: Ability of Unifier to connect to the database Level of permissions granted to the database login user account Database Tab (MS SQL Server) The information entered in this tab is based upon your earlier database and user account creation. Database Type: Select MS SQL Server to configure for Microsoft SQL Server. Host Name: Enter the host name of the computer where you installed and configured Microsoft SQL Server database. Instance ID: If you did not specify an instance name when configuring the SQL Server, leave the Instance ID field blank. Otherwise, enter the Instance ID. Port: Enter the Port number to be used by Unifier to communicate with the Microsoft SQL Server database. User Name: Enter the database login user account name for the Microsoft SQL Server database to be used by Unifier. User Password: Enter the database login user account name password for the Microsoft SQL Server database to be used by Unifier. Database Name: Enter the database name (if applicable). Max. Connections: The setting that defines the maximum connections to the database. The recommended setting is 100. Min. Connections: The setting that defines the minimum connections that must be connected to the database. Click Test Connection to verify that the Application server and the Microsoft SQL Server database are connected and communicating. Tab Outbound (SMTP) Server: Enter the IP address for the SMTP Server. This is required. System Notification Address: This is the ID that displays as the Sender s e- mail address for all s generated by the Unifier system. Example: admin@xyz.com Sender Prefix: Provide the prefix that will be used in the Sender s name whenever is generated from a user from within Unifier. Example: Unifier Login URL: The URL included in all notifications to users logged into the system. Note: The Login URL Must contain the fully qualified server name to establish successful connection to the application server. Otherwise, the interactive logins will not work. Support Contact Information: The message text included in all Support notifications. Support Address: The address for the Support group. System Error Notification Address: The address where Unifier sends a notification if it loses connection to the database while the system is running. License Notification Address: The address where Unifier sends licensing notifications, for example, if number of users is exceeded. Copyright 1998, 2012 Oracle and/or its affiliates. 16 Inbound (pop3) Server: Enter the server that can receive (for example, if a user takes action via on a business process). This can be the server name or IP address. Inbound Account: Create an account on the inbound server; this is where any inbound s will be sent. Note: To use the project or shell Mailbox, which allows external messages to be sent to and stored within a central project or shell mailbox, use the following format for the inbound account. This allows acceptance of inbound s sent to the system-generated project/shell addresses: *-inbound name@yourcompany.com Inbound Password: This is the password that corresponds to the inbound account. This password is used when is retrieved. Note: Click the Test Inbound Account button to test the Inbound Server, Inbound Account, and Inbound Password. Markup Server Tab Enable Markup Server: To use Unifier markup capabilities, click Yes. If you are not using the markup feature, click No. Markup Server Host Name: Enter the host name of the markup server. Markup Server Port: Enter the port number of the markup server. Report Tab Report Mode: Enterprise or Typical APS Host Name: Enter the name of the computer configured as the Unifier Reports Server. Authentication Type: Security mechanism APS User Name: User name created on the APS server Data Source: ODBC Datasource name entered when configuring the ODBC Data Source for Enterprise reports Report Folder: Enter the name of the virtual directory you created in IIS during setup of the Reports Server. BIP Endpoint URL: Enter the BIP Web Services endpoint URL. For example, BIP User Name: Enter the user name created for the BI Publisher server. BIP Password: Enter the password for the BI Publisher user. BIP Data Source: Enter the JDBC data source name that was entered when the JDBC Data Source BI Publisher BIP Report folder: The folder under the default location in the BI Publisher catalog. Reports reside in this folder based on company registry. Other Tab Login Session Timeout: Login Session Timeout is used to control the amount of time a user can be idle before having to log back into Unifier. The unit is seconds. For security reasons, the recommended timeout setting is between 30 minutes and 4 hours. Copyright 1998, 2012 Oracle and/or its affiliates. All Rights Reserved. 12

17 Late Notice Interval: Interval, in minutes, used by the internal job server for notification tasks. The suggested interval is 15 minutes. A very small interval may degrade performance. JVM Options: Maximum and minimum Java heap sizes. -Xms1536m -Xmx1536m -XX:- DoEscapeAnalysis Note: If you have added additional JVM Options for earlier versions, these should be removed before attempting to start Unifier; otherwise the Unifier service will not start. It is recommended to set a larger heap value (-Xms1536m Xmx1536m) if your environment permits it. The XX options are automatically set, so the only settings to specify are the Xms and Xmx options, along with the one XX setting of -XX:MaxPermSize=128m. XREF Service Port: Port used by the XREF server to communicate with Unifier. Max. Concurrent Logins: The setting for the maximum number of concurrent users that can log into the system. The recommended setting is 400. Max. Threads per Server: The setting for the maximum number of worker threads per server. The recommended setting is 75. Server Type: The setting that defines the mode Unifier server is running. Set Server Type to Production if this Unifier installation is acting as the Unifier production environment. Set Server Type to Staging if this Unifier installation is acting as the staging server for testing of business processes and other Unifier designs and configurations. Note: You must set the Server Type to Staging if you want to use Primavera udesigner. If you do not select Staging, you will be unable to initiate udesigner because the Design Mode option for udesigner will not appear on the User Mode menu, available from the Unifier Home tab. If working in a clustered environment, then all servers in a cluster should be set with same Server Type. Background Job Disabled: If this checkbox is not selected, then any background process (e.g., project archiving, update projects, scheduled UDRs and cash flow refresh) will run on this Unifier application server. In a cluster environment, one of the Unifier application servers can be dedicated to running background jobs by using this option. XREF Service Host: Name of the machine used as the XREF server. The default is localhost, indicating the same machine on which Unifier is installed. If XREF is on another machine, enter the host name. Saving the Configuration Data You must save your configuration data to a configuration file. To save the configuration data: From the Unifier Configuration window, click File and choose Save. 18 Starting and Stopping Primavera Unifier and Xref Services After a new installation, the Unifier Service and Xref Service functions must be started. Once the services have been started, they must be stopped before you can make any changes to the configuration settings or before importing a configuration file. Be sure to restart the services afterward. To start the Unifier and Xref Services 1. From the Unifier Configurator window, click Tools > Unifier Service. The Unifier Service window opens. When Unifier service is stopped, the traffic light is red. 2. Click Start to start the Unifier Service. When the service is running, the light appears green. 3. Click Close. 4. From the Unifier Configurator window, click on Tools > Xref Service. The Xref Service window opens. 5. Click Start to start the service, and then click Close to close the window. To stop the services 1. From the Unifier Configurator window, choose Tools > Unifier Service. Click Stop, and then click Close. 2. Choose Tools > Xref, click Stop, and then click Close. Be sure to restart the services before running Unifier. You can also start and stop XREF and Unifier services from the Windows Services Manager. From the Control Panel, double-click Administrative Tools, and then double-click Services. The Services window opens. Scroll down to Unifier Service and xrefservice. Select the service to start/stop. Click the Stop icon at the top of the window to stop service, and the Start icon to start service. If IIS is used as the web server then go to the Services window, scroll down to World Wide Web Publishing Service and make sure that it is started. If not, select it and click the Start icon. Editing Configuration Data If you need to make changes to the configuration data, you must stop the Unifier and Xref services first, and then restart after making changes. To edit configuration data 1. Follow the above steps to stop the Unifier Service and Xref Service. 2. Make necessary configuration changes, and then click File > Save. 3. Restart the Unifier Service and Xref Service. Copyright 1998, 2012 Oracle and/or its affiliates. All Rights Reserved. 14

19 Exporting Configuration Data The configuration data file is typically exported and used for setting up application servers in a clustered environment or for supporting multi-machine configurations. You may also import the configuration file to reconfigure the server after installing a version upgrade. Once the file is imported, save the new configuration and then stop and restart the services for the configuration to take effect. Unifier configuration files have the extension.cfg. To export your configuration data 1. From the Unifier Configuration window, click the File menu and choose Export. The Export window opens. 2. Navigate to the location to where you want to save the configuration file. You may make a new folder at the root directory for this purpose. Do not include any spaces in the folder name, for example, c:\cfgbackup). 3. Name the configuration file and click Save. This export file can be used to import your configuration details. It can be copied to additional Unifier Application servers in your configuration. Once you import a configuration you can change the parameters at any time. Remember to save the new configuration before you start the Unifier and Xref Services. Importing Configuration Data Before importing new configuration files, you must first stop the Unifier Service and Xref Service. To import a configuration file 1. From the Unifier Configurator window, choose Tools > Unifier Service to open the window, click Stop, and then click Close. 2. Choose Tools > Xref Service, click Stop, and then click Close. 3. Click the File menu and choose Import. 4. Navigate to the configuration file location, select the file to be imported and click Open. The configuration settings will populate the Unifier Configurator window. You may make manual modifications as necessary to the configuration data. 5. Click File > Save to save the new settings. 6. Restart the Unifier Service and Xref Service. Copyright 1998, 2012 Oracle and/or its affiliates. All Rights Reserved. 15

20 Chapter 6 Configuring the Web Server This chapter describes how to: Configure the web server. Instructions are provided for Windows 2000, 2003 and Windows 2000 Configuration IIS ISAPI Filter Information ISAPI filter installation is part of the Unifier install process. The Unifier installation automatically replaces the existing ISAPI filter installed on the Default Website. IIS Properties Modification In order to take advantage of serving static files through the IIS, the Unifier directory s Local Path is changed during installation to the directory where Unifier is installed. Make sure that NTFS permissions are available on the Unifier directory so that the contents can be accessed via Web. Windows 2003 Configuration IIS ISAPI Filter Information ISAPI filter installation is part of the Primavera Unifier install process. The Primavera Unifier installation automatically replaces the existing ISAPI filter installed on the Default Website. ISAPI Filter Verification of Installation To verify whether the Jakarta ISAPI filter is installed 1. Open the Default Web Site Properties window and click on ISAPI Filters. 2. Check if the Jakarta ISAPI filter is installed. 3. If it is not already installed, add the filter. To add the Jakarta ISAPI filter For this procedure, it is assumed that Unifier is installed at the root directory C:\Unifier. Substitute your Unifier installation folder location if necessary. 1. Open the Default Web Site Properties window, and click the ISAPI Filters tab. 2. Click on Add. 3. Browse to C:\Unifier\connectors\jk1.2.x\bin\isapi_redirect.dll (or the folder where you have installed Unifier). 4. Click OK. 5. Make sure the Web Services Extension is configured correctly (Only applies to IIS 6.0 on Windows 2003). Copyright 1998, 2012 Oracle and/or its affiliates. All Rights Reserved. 16

21 6. Enable Jakarta Web Service Extension on IIS C:\Unifier\connectors\jk1.0\bin\ isapi_redirect.dll 7. If you cannot start Jakarta ISAPI or IIS, go to the Service tab of the Web Sites Properties window and verify that the Run WWW service in IIS 5.0 isolation mode checkbox is selected, otherwise the Web Services Extension and IIS 6.0 may not work correctly. 8. Click on the Home Directory tab. In the Execute Permissions dropdown box, select Scripts and Executables (the default is Scripts Only). Windows 2008 Configuration To run Primavera Unifier on Windows 2008, there are a few things to keep in mind: Primavera Unifier supports 32-bit Windows If you are running Windows 2008 R2 (which is 64-bit), you must choose the Enable 32-bit option (discussed in the following sections). You may need to use the Windows 2008 Run as Administrator option to run certain tasks, including the installation of Primavera Unifier. (Open the command window and type Run as Administrator. ) Windows 2008 support requires configuration of IIS 7. Required IIS 7 Features In addition to the default features that are installed as part of the Internet Information Services (IIS) 7 installation, there are some additional role services that are required in order to run Primavera Unifier. If you already have IIS installed, you can add the features by doing the following: 1. Click the Windows Start button and select Administrative Tools. 2. Click Server Manager. The Server Manager window opens. 3. Click Roles > Webserver IIS. 4. Click Add Role Sevices. 5. After selecting the additional features, click Next, then click Install. 6. Click Close. Additional IIS 7 features: Under Common HTTP Features, select all features. Under Application Development, select CGI ISAPI Extensions ISAPI Filters Under Health and Diagnostics, select HTTP Logging Request Monitor Under Security, select Basic Authentication Request Filtering Window Authentication Copyright 1998, 2012 Oracle and/or its affiliates. 22 Under Performance, select all features. Under Management Tools, select all features. Note: When you check Management Service, it will prompt you to add additional Window Process Activation Services,.NET environment. Select the Add Required Feature button. Configure IIS 7 This configuration procedure will enable IIS 7 to work with Primavera Unifier. To configure IIS 7 for use with Primavera Unifier 1. Open the IIS Manager window. (From the Control Panel, click Administrative Tools > Internet Information Services (IIS) Manager.) 2. On the node for the server, double-click the ISAPI and CGI Restrictions icon. 3. In the Actions pane, click Add. The Add ISAPI and CGI Restrictions window opens. 4. In the ISAPI or CGI Path field, enter C:\Unifier\connectors\jk1.2.x\bin\isapi_redirect.dll (or the folder where you have installed Unifier). 5. Select the Allow extension path to execute checkbox and click OK. 6. In the Actions pane, click the Edit Feature Settings link, then select the Allow unspecified ISAPI modules checkbox. 7. If you are using Windows 2008 R2 (64-bit), then do the following: In the Connections pane, click Application Pools. In the Application Pools pane, click DefaultAppPool. In the Actions pane, click Advanced Settings. Set Enable 32-bit Applications to True. Click OK. 8. Open a command prompt as Administrator, cd to the Unifier\bin directory, and run iis_install to set up and install the Tomcat connector ISAPI filter. 28 Chapter 8 Upgrading Primavera Unifier This chapter describes how to upgrade to the latest version of Primavera Unifier. Primavera Unifier System Upgrade Steps The following steps are provided as a reference for upgrading Primavera Unifier. The procedures follow. Step 1 Back up the current File Repository and Database Step 2 Export a copy of the Configuration file Step 3 Uninstall current version of Unifier Step 4 Install new version of Unifier Step 5 Import the Configuration file and start services Step 6 Verify Unifier Installation Step 7 Perform Data Migration 1. Back up File Repository and Database Follow your company s procedures for creating a backup copy of the File Repository and Database. The file locations were set during configuration of Unifier and can be found in the Unifier Configurator. To view the Unifier Configurator window 1. From the Windows Start menu, click Programs > Unifier > Unifier Configurator. The Unifier Configurator window opens. 2. Click each tab to review file locations and other settings. 2. Export a Copy of the Configuration File The next step is to export a copy of the Unifier Configuration file, if you have not already done so. This file stores the information contained in the Unifier Configurator. The Configuration file will be imported back into the Unifier Configurator upon completion of the application installation. This ensures that the Unifier system can correctly locate the file system, Reports Server and database previously used. For more information, see Exporting Configuration Data on page Uninstall Current Version of Primavera Unifier This section describes how to uninstall the current version of Primavera Unifier and update report file (reinstall Reports Server). Be sure to uninstall all existing Primavera Unifier components before installing the latest version. Copyright 1998, 2012 Oracle and/or its affiliates. All Rights Reserved. 24

29 To prepare for the uninstall 1. Stop the Unifier and XREF Services on all machines within the environment (including a cluster environment if it exists). See Starting and Stopping Primavera Unifier and Xref Services on page Ensure all open windows related to Unifier are closed, including any administrative tools such as Windows Services. To uninstall Unifier 1. From the Windows Start menu, click Programs > Unifier [version no.] > Uninstall Unifier. 2. Click the Uninstall button. This will uninstall Unifier, remove the services and remove the directory. 3. During the uninstall process, you are prompted to remove all files. Click Yes to remove all the files in the Unifier directory. 4. Navigate to the Unifier server and verify that the files and the Unifier directory were successfully removed. 5. If you receive a message that all of the files could not be removed, reboot the server before continuing. 4. Install New Version of Primavera Unifier Now you are ready to install the latest version of Primavera Unifier. Depending upon the configuration chosen for your company, this will include the following: Installing Primavera Unifier (See Chapter 2 Installing Primavera Unifier for details) Updating Report file (reinstall Reports Server) 5. Import the Configuration File and Start Services Import the Configuration file that you saved before you began the uninstall process. Upon importing this configuration file, the Unifier file system, database and reports previously used in the old version will be configured to work with the new Primavera Unifier. To import the configuration file 1. From the Windows Start menu, click Programs > Unifier > Unifier Configurator. The Unifier Configurator window opens. 2. Click the File menu and choose Import. 3. At the prompt, click Yes. 4. Navigate to the configuration file you exported at the beginning of the upgrade process. 5. After importing, click each of the tabs in the Configurator window to validate that the information was imported correctly. 6. Click the File menu and choose Save to save the configuration. It is recommended that you upgrade all servers in a cluster environment before restarting any service. Copyright 1998, 2012 Oracle and/or its affiliates. All Rights Reserved. 25
